548,528 is a composite number, even.
548,528 (five hundred forty-eight thousand five hundred twenty-eight) is an even 6-digit number. It is a composite number with 10 divisors, and factors as 2⁴ × 34,283. Written other ways, in hexadecimal, 0x85EB0.
